The at above quoted provisions above quoted for strengthening
the limits of justice are manyform part of
a numerous and confused al heap of provisions
of the same tendency embellished by Statutes upon
Statutes in the case of offences against the Laws
of Excise and Customs, among which are several
more that would require to be applied to the offences
against the present Bill, were it not for the voluminousness
and perplexity that would be the result.
